Pros

Unlimited vacation days, completely flexible work model, young , smart and dynamic team, all in the context of a fast-growing company

Cons

Any cons would really have to be nitpicky--I haven't experienced, heard or witnessed anything bad, really. I suppose that with a remote-first approach, it means that it is a little more difficult to get the full team experience as a f2f experience would deliver. But, honestly, I haven't suffered of it yet--people make a genuine effort to stay connected.
